Zscaler Inc (0XVU.L) QQ3 2025 Earnings Analysis: Revenue Growth Gains Traction Against Margin Pressures; Strong Liquidity Supports Growth

Executive Summary

Zscaler reported Q3 2025 revenue of $678.0 million, up 22.6% year over year and 4.6% quarter over quarter, with gross profit of $522.1 million and a robust gross margin of approximately 77%. Despite top-line growth, operating income remained negative at -$25.4 million (margin -3.74%), reflecting ongoing investments in go-to-market and R&D as the company scales. EBITDA stood at $39.0 million (margin ~5.75%), and net income was a small loss of -$4.13 million (EPS -$0.03). Free cash flow reached $119.5 million, supported by operating cash flow of $211.1 million and capital expenditures of $91.6 million. The balance sheet remains highly liquid, with cash and cash equivalents of $1.99 billion and total cash and short-term investments of $3.01 billion, producing a net cash position of approximately -$762 million (net debt). These dynamics underscore a growth-at-scale profile: strong revenue momentum and cash generation, offset by margin compression from continued investment and non-operational tax effects.
